Subject: On-call handover — replica lag alarm

Hi Dovren,

Handing over the pager for Merrowbase. The read-replica lag alarm on cluster `emberline-2` fired twice overnight; lag peaked at 140s, likely from the analytics batch job that Tallis rescheduled last week. I silenced it for six hours but did not change thresholds — please confirm lag returns below 10s before un-silencing. Graphs and my notes are in the Merrowbase dashboard under "replica-health." If anything is unclear, write to me here.

billing contact of bagef-kawef = prawyn@lumicnet.test

HANDOVER — Pilot Churn, Saltwick Programme

Quick handover as you take over. Churn in the Saltwick pilot hit 18% last month — mostly small accounts citing onboarding friction. The retention squad has fixes queued; give them two sprints before judging. Escalations route through Dana Pryce. The strategic angle is in the note below.

board note of kageg-bahof: The renewal with Holwynax Holdings closes at $2 million a year, 5 percent below the last contract. Project Ulaath slips by two quarters because of the supplier delay.

Subject: On-call heads-up — Orchardly catalog cache. Welcome aboard. The main gotcha: catalog price updates invalidate by SKU, but bundle pages cache composite keys, so a stale bundle can outlive its parts. If support reports wrong bundle prices, purge the composite namespace first. We'll cover this at the weekly sync; the invalidation playbook is on this internal page.

wiki page, yagef-tawif: https://sentry.lumicdata.local/view/merge_requests/pipeline/merge_requests/e08f7f35c80b5755